MANILA, Philippines — Tropical storm Hagupit which is being monitored outside the Philippine area of responsibility (PAR) is not forecast not make landfall in the country but it will cause cloudy skies over parts of Eastern Visayas and Bicol next week, the state weather bureau said on Friday. In its 5 p.m. bulletin, Philippine Atmospheric, Geophysical, and Astronomical Services Administration (Pagasa) weather specialist Obet Badrina said that the tropical storm is expected to enter the PAR on Saturday and will be given the local name “Caloy.” It will be the third tropical cyclone to enter the country this year, and […]...
